Mineral Springs Quote Checklist

Use these checks when comparing exterminators serving Mineral Springs. They are designed to make each estimate more specific, easier to verify, and less dependent on generic averages.

  • Separate general pest service from termite, bed bug, mosquito, and wildlife work.
  • Confirm re-treatment windows, interior access requirements, and pet re-entry instructions.
  • Ask which pests are included in the treatment plan and which require separate pricing.
  • Ask whether exterior barrier service, bait stations, and follow-up visits are included.
  • Ask for the estimate, warranty, exclusions, and scheduling assumptions in writing.

Estimate itemWhy it mattersQuestion to ask
Pest categoryGeneral insects, termites, bed bugs, mosquitoes, and wildlife are usually scoped and priced separately.Which pests are covered by this visit and which need a separate quote?
Follow-up policyA cheap first visit can be poor value if retreatment or monitoring is excluded.How many visits are included, and what triggers a no-charge callback?
Warranty limitsSome warranties exclude sanitation issues, structural entry points, or heavy infestations.What conditions would void the service guarantee?
Exterior conditionsMoisture, mulch, vegetation, gaps, and entry points affect whether treatment holds.Which exterior conditions should the homeowner correct before or after service?

When to Call Now vs. Plan Ahead in Mineral Springs

Call sooner when you see

  • Active stinging insects near an entry, walkway, deck, or play area.
  • Rodent activity inside living space, attic, basement, garage, or stored food.
  • Suspected bed bugs, termites, or wood-destroying insects.

Plan ahead for

  • Seasonal exterior barrier service before peak activity.
  • Inspection before a sale, lease turnover, or long vacancy.
  • Exclusion work after entry points have been identified.

How Mineral Springs Homeowners Can Prevent Infestations

Reduce pest problems in your Mineral Springs home with these prevention strategies:

  • Seal entry points – Inspect foundations and weather stripping, especially important given North Carolina's termite damage in older homes with wood foundations.
  • Reduce moisture – Fix leaks promptly; termites and other pests are attracted to water sources.
  • Store food properly – Use sealed containers to avoid attracting carpenter ants and rodents.
  • Maintain your yard – Trim vegetation away from your home to reduce pest harborage areas.
  • Schedule regular inspections – Given North Carolina's high termite risk, annual inspections are wise.

What happens if pests return after treatment in Mineral Springs?

Reputable Mineral Springs pest control companies include re-treatment guarantees. If pests return within the warranty period, they'll return at no extra cost. Most warranties cover 30-90 days after treatment. Always get warranty terms in writing.

Should I leave during pest control treatment in Mineral Springs?

For standard treatments in Mineral Springs, you typically don't need to leave. For fumigation or severe infestations, you may need to vacate for 24-72 hours. Your North Carolina technician will advise based on the specific treatment.
